The cost of car diagnostics varies depending on the type of vehicle and the potential issues. While some diagnostics can cost as low as $40, more intricate tests can cost several hundred dollars.

The majority of modern cars are equipped with on-board computers that regulate many aspects of the car. These computers monitor a number of systems, including the ignition system, the fuel injection system, as well as the automatic transmission. They continuously collect data from sensors to verify they're operating properly. If any of the sensors are malfunctioning, the check engine light will flash across the dashboard.

A diagnostic test can also help pinpoint the exact issue a car is having. The test involves connecting your car's computer to a diagnosis machine. This test is fast and will quickly inform the mechanic what's going on with your vehicle. It can also uncover issues in your computer or other systems.
